Understanding Mosquito-Borne Viruses

Mosquitoes transmit a variety of serious viruses that can cause illness in individuals. These small insects serve as vectors, meaning they pick up viruses from sick creatures and then relay them to other hosts. Common examples feature viruses like Zika, Dengue, West Nile, and Chikungunya, each presenting unique symptoms and possible complications. Awareness of these viruses and how they propagate is crucial for avoiding outbreaks and defending public health .

Mosquito Illnesses: Symptoms and Prevention

Mosquitoes can transmit a number of harmful diseases, like malaria, dengue illness, Zika virus, West Nile infection, and chikungunya. Common symptoms include high temperature, headache, body aches, joint pain, redness, and weakness. Preventing mosquito bites is essential - this involves using bug spray, wearing covering clothing, draining standing water around your property, and using bug screens when sleeping. Consulting a healthcare professional is advised if you have any worrying symptoms, especially after traveling to an region known to have mosquito-borne diseases.
